Driving directions to Bath & Body Works in Virginia, Winchester (located in Apple Blossom Mall, Address: 1850 Apple Blossom Dr, Winchester, VA 22601)
Look at driving directions and map to Bath & Body Works located in Virginia VA 22601, Winchester (Apple Blossom Mall). Our guide will show you driving directions step by step.